Carter experienced the evolution of semiconductors from the single transistor on a silicon chip to millions of transistors on a chip over the next fifty years. He also participated in the birth of the personal computer industry at Apple Computer, Inc. where he developed a sales team in the new selling environment of personal computer sales outlets.
